i chatted with 3 of your colleagues and all 3 said my replacement boost pump from you guys is B625.

I received the pump yesterday. at a general glance i think the B625 pump you sent is to short compared to my old pump and my old motor seems to be permanently attached to the impeller. see attch.

your how-to video shows several bolts connecting the pump to the impeller housing. my current old pump does bot have such bolts connecting the 2.

whats the fix, solution, where do we go from here?

jeff freeny

Hi Jeff,

You will need to take the front motor mounting plate off of your old motor to access those 4 bolts. You will remove the motor mounting plate by removing your impeller. See this Video on How to Remove an Impeller.
